Abstract
Cancer diagnosis can be considered as a powerful stressor that could provoke emotional reactions (especially anxiety and depression)even emotional disorders (anxiety and mood disorders). Relationship between cancer and these psychological factors is reviewed. Cancer patients present lower levels of anxiety but similar or higher levels of depression, assessed by self-report questionnaires, than their corresponding controls. Anxiety disorders present similar twelve-month prevalence in cancer patients and in general population, meanwhile mood disorders are more prevalent in cancer patients.
